长海股份(300196) - 2020 Q1 - 季度财报
CHANGHAICHANGHAI(SZ:300196)2020-04-27 16:00

Financial Performance - Total operating revenue for Q1 2020 was ¥395,764,567.29, a decrease of 23.77% compared to ¥519,167,005.49 in the same period last year[7] - Net profit attributable to shareholders was ¥56,065,684.55, an increase of 1.87% from ¥55,037,121.83 year-on-year[7] - Net profit excluding non-recurring gains and losses was ¥52,032,649.94, up 2.27% from ¥50,877,259.55 in the previous year[7] - Basic earnings per share rose to ¥0.1400, reflecting a 7.69% increase from ¥0.1300[7] - Operating profit increased by 3.02% year-on-year to 67.00 million yuan, while total profit rose by 2.82% to 66.84 million yuan[21] - Net profit attributable to the parent company was 56.07 million yuan, reflecting a year-on-year growth of 1.87%[21] - The company reported a total comprehensive income of CNY 56,218,233.52 for Q1 2020, compared to CNY 54,712,222.64 in the previous year[44] - The total comprehensive income for the first quarter of 2020 was CNY 45,457,092.84, compared to CNY 44,703,821.58 in the previous period, reflecting a slight increase[48] Cash Flow - Net cash flow from operating activities reached ¥36,950,669.60, a significant increase of 283.26% compared to ¥9,641,068.17 in the same period last year[7] - Net cash flow from operating activities surged by 283.26% from CNY 9,641,068.17 to CNY 36,950,669.60[18] - Cash inflow from operating activities amounted to CNY 371,130,329.11, up from CNY 362,698,104.29 in the previous period, indicating a growth of approximately 0.12%[50] - The net cash flow from operating activities was CNY 36,950,669.60, significantly higher than CNY 9,641,068.17 in the previous period, marking an increase of 283.5%[51] - Cash outflow from investing activities totaled CNY 197,197,237.21, compared to CNY 227,837,804.73 in the previous period, showing a decrease of about 13.5%[51] - The net cash flow from investing activities was -CNY 82,002,957.94, worsening from -CNY 24,785,537.12 in the previous period[51] - Cash inflow from financing activities was CNY 20,000,000.00, down from CNY 145,000,000.00 in the previous period, a decline of approximately 86.2%[53] - The net cash flow from financing activities was -CNY 12,875,120.60, compared to a positive net flow of CNY 79,149,665.22 in the previous period[53] Assets and Liabilities - Total assets at the end of the reporting period were ¥3,218,363,486.62, a 1.03% increase from ¥3,185,675,633.58 at the end of the previous year[7] - Current assets totaled CNY 1,565,976,595.96, slightly up from CNY 1,559,108,704.78, indicating a growth of about 0.12%[34] - The company's cash and cash equivalents decreased to CNY 570,461,402.91 from CNY 624,276,737.81, representing a decline of approximately 8.63%[34] - Total liabilities decreased to CNY 444,069,875.13 from CNY 453,848,935.16, a reduction of approximately 2.18%[36] - Total liabilities increased to CNY 294,788,175.06 from CNY 262,820,636.60, indicating a rise of approximately 12.1%[42] - Total equity rose to CNY 2,442,131,753.07 from CNY 2,396,674,660.23, marking an increase of about 1.9%[42] Shareholder Information - The company had a total of 8,928 common shareholders at the end of the reporting period[11] - The largest shareholder, Yang Pengwei, held 41.06% of the shares, totaling 170,474,412 shares[11] - Minority shareholders' profit increased by 146.95% from CNY -324,899.19 to CNY 152,548.97[18] Operational Changes and Challenges - The company plans to upgrade and expand its unsaturated polyester resin production line from an annual capacity of 25,000 tons to 100,000 tons, enhancing competitiveness and compliance with environmental regulations[22] - The COVID-19 pandemic has negatively impacted production and sales due to reduced demand from downstream enterprises[22] - Macro-economic risks, including fluctuations in demand and production, may impact the company's export business and overall performance[24] - The company is implementing measures to mitigate exchange rate risks associated with its export business, primarily denominated in USD[25] Compliance and Governance - Environmental protection compliance is a priority, with the company adhering to regulations and investing in pollution control measures[26] -
